At the head of a regiment of 900 active soldiers and 250 reservists, she became the first woman to be commander of the Train. Ready to take on many challenges.

Solemn atmosphere this Wednesday morning, around the vast parade ground, at the heart of the 503rd Train regiment, based in Garons. A regiment specializing in force logistics, which transports resources and supplies the units. In front of numerous officials, Colonel Nicolas Vergos, in post for two years, handed over command to Fanny Peluttiero for a period of two years.

He left for the First Army Corps in Lille, as an expert officer in operational logistics, strong “a rich operational experience in the 503rd Train Regiment: I participated in Operation Sentinel in Ile-de-France with 200 people from the regiment but where I commanded a tactical group of 900 soldiers from all arms or even a signaling exercise strategic in Romania”. And he will remember some Gard“a land of very strong traditions, the day of arrivals in a herd in Saint-Gilles and my first bullfight”. Completely exotic for this original Breton!

It is Colonel Fanny Peluttiero who takes the head of the 503rd Train regiment, previously assigned to the logistics headquarters in Essonne. Originally from Draguignan, she attended Saint-Cyr, the war school, and was posted for eight years in Burgundy and ten years in the Paris region.

One of its biggest challenges for the next two years will be the Allied Reaction Force (ARF), a high-level multinational NATO readiness force. “Concretely, troops are on alert for a year from July 1, to be able to intervene in the event of attacks. In the 503rd RT, around 550 people are involved who will participate in operational preparation”she specifies. The regiment will also continue its engagement in Operation Sentinelle.

The 503rd Train regiment has 900 active soldiers and 250 reservists.

Parade on the Champs-Élysées on July 14

It has been more than five years since the 503rd RT last paraded in Paris. Having barely arrived at command, Colonel Peluttiero will therefore participate in the July 14 parade this summer in Paris. “It’s a very great honor and a challenge,” she explains. We practice this exercise quite infrequently on this scale.” Around 90 soldiers from our regiment will participate in a parade on foot. They will reach the capital from July 6 to carry out numerous rehearsals before D-Day when everything must be perfect.

First woman, corps commander in the Train army, she ensures that “to command well you have to be yourself, have particular skills and appetites, but man or woman, it doesn’t change anything even if I perhaps have a slightly more mothering style of command”.

While the international context is very tense, she, like her predecessor, confirms that the armies are preparing to “a high intensity commitment” with hardening of operational preparation. “Since Mali and Afghanistan which were demanding missions, we continue… The enemy and the threats have evolved, we have toughened preparation to get used to working in difficult conditions”, explains Ganny Peluttiero.
